Tipping the Water Bottle - Chozen, Roshi
from Zen Community of Oregon Dharma Talks · host Zen Community of Oregon
In this Rohatsu sesshin talk, Chozen reflects on awakening, silent mind, and the constructed personality that both protects and confines us. Drawing on the Buddha’s own awakening, the teaching of “don’t-know mind” from Seung Sahn Sunim, Eckhart Tolle’s modern account of disidentification from thought, and the koan of Isan tipping over the water bottle, she points to the moment when thinking falls away and original mind reveals itself—vast, intimate, and free from entanglement.
